Output 8899518f1a061bc81ed231bfd8e691a71a614a1ec06a51fbfff4471cbf125caf:1

value
1059338
script pubkey
OP_0 OP_PUSHBYTES_20 8d77077d28f83da8a05b35ba41ecb7ab81dbb090
address
bc1q34mswlfglq763gzmxkayrm9h4wqahvys2afs3a
transaction
8899518f1a061bc81ed231bfd8e691a71a614a1ec06a51fbfff4471cbf125caf